During processing antimony is mobilized reporting to waste solid tailings or effluent streams. This becomes a matter of concern since antimony is similar to arsenic in many respects, both sharing similar chemical properties as well as toxicity and thus have negative environmental implications, especially in the context of industrial effluents ...

Techniques for the processing of antimony-bearing ores encompass a wide range of techniques from traditional hand sorting, which is dependent on plentiful and cheap labour, to technologically advanced, capital-intensive mineral processing. The problem discussed in this antimony process study is limited to a concentrator capable of beneficiating 150 tons per day of antimony ore.The antimony in this study occurs as the mineral stibnite (Sb2S3) in association with small amounts of pyrite, arsenopyrite, galena and lead sulfantimonides. The working conditions in antimony processing have improved markedly over the last 30 years and the workforce has been much reduced in numbers following automation of the process. The health of antimony workers was a concern of Sir Thomas Oliver (1853–1942), who was distinguished in the field of occupational medicine.

Antimony is finding use in semiconductor technology for making infrared detectors, diodes and Hall-effect devices. It greatly increases the hardness and mechanical strength of lead. Batteries, antifriction alloys, type metal, small arms and tracer bullets, cable sheathing, and minor products use about half the metal produced.
